Philippines - Export of Not Self-Propelled Coal or Rock Cutters
Since 2014, Philippines Export of Not Self-Propelled Coal or Rock Cutters rose 45.5% year on year. With $1,669,711 in 2019, the country was number 24 comparing other countries in Export of Not Self-Propelled Coal or Rock Cutters. Philippines is overtaken by Switzerland, which was number 23 at $1,708,341.63 and is followed by South Africa at $1,581,714.7. Germany lead the ranking with $355,257,933.01 in 2019, +5.2% compared to 2018. Australia, Italy and Japan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Slovenia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+374.7% per year, while Chile recorded the worst performance at -80% per year.
